**Handover — crossword generator (Gridwright)**

Clue-dedup job fixed; rebuild runs nightly. Release 2.4 tagged, changelog done. Known issue: themed puzzles over 21x21 time out — patch in review. Seed corpus lives in the sealed config store; release manager needs it unlocked before cutting 2.5. Unlock prompt appears on first deploy. Enter the recovery passphrase below when asked.

unlock words, yawig-kagef: gordor-holvan-ulaael-pramir-ulaiel-tamdor

Internal memo — Raffle drums for the Culverton staff party. Receiving site: two brass raffle drums arrive Wednesday from Pemberly Events Hire, crated separately with the ticket stock sealed inside drum one. Please inspect both crates for transit damage on arrival, confirm the seals are unbroken, and store them in the locked events cupboard until Friday afternoon. Do not load tickets or open the seals before the compère arrives. The courier should be given this instruction at hand-over.

handover note for yagef-bagep: the drudor pelius courier leaves the kasdor zorvan norir ledger at gate 8016 under passcode 755406

Subject: DR drill this Friday — heads up, support!

Hi all,

Quick note before Friday's disaster-recovery drill for SketchLoom, our diagram editor. We'll be failing over the history service, which powers undo and redo. During the ~30 minute window, users might see undo stacks temporarily frozen — please log tickets but don't escalate. Redo should come back first, undo shortly after.

If anyone needs to manually restart the history daemon during the drill, it'll ask for the recovery passphrase, which I'm pasting right here.

strongbox words: zorath-holmir

## Environments: Fan-out & Backpressure

Welcome aboard! Lanternjay's notification service fans out events to push, email, and in-app channels. In staging we deliberately throttle fan-out so one noisy tenant can't flood the queue — you'll see backpressure kick in around peak test runs. Prod limits are higher but the mechanism is identical. The staging backpressure settings currently in effect are listed below:

deployment values, kajep-kageg:
[praix]
host = praix.paliqcorp.corp
user = praix_svc
database = praix_prod